India’s development discourse is undergoing a marked transformation—from a state-driven welfare model to a more decentralised and participatory approach. Traditional top-down delivery systems are giving way to frameworks that emphasise local governance, digital empowerment, and community ownership of development outcomes.

The rise of Panchayati Raj Institutions, Self-Help Groups (SHGs), and community-based organisations has redefined rural development as a collaborative process, not a one-way flow of benefits.

At the same time, NGOs and civil society actors are evolving from being service providers to enablers of local capacity and accountability, helping communities design and sustain their own development agendas. However, challenges remain, including tighter regulations, funding constraints, and a gradual shift in welfare policy toward fiscal decentralisation and administrative discretion are there.

Overall, India’s community development sector stands at a crossroads with the growing energy of local participation and grassroots innovation.

Throwback to 2013 | Khawatein Bedari Karvaan, Seemanchal (Bihar, India) by "Bihar Rabita Commitee" https://rabita.in/

In 2013, the Khawatein Bedari Karvaan organized across the Seemanchal districts of Bihar became a powerful platform for women’s awareness and collective strength. I had the opportunity to address a gathering of over 5,000 women, focusing on the importance of linking vulnerable families to government social security schemes to ensure maximum access to entitlements and long-term security.

The dialogue went beyond awareness—leading to action. Following the Karvaan, a compendium on government social security schemes was released as a ready reckoner, helping women and families better understand benefits, eligibility, and application processes.

During my association with OFFER for Islamic Relief’s Sponsorship Programme, I had the opportunity to present this model at a global meet in Istanbul in 2019—highlighting it as one of the pioneering initiatives supporting orphan families through dignified, family-based care in India.
The programme goes beyond short-term aid, focusing on hand-holding support that empowers families to graduate out of poverty sustainably. Through structured guidance, strong monitoring mechanisms, and accountable institutional processes, it ensures support reaches where it matters most—without creating dependency.
The result is lasting change, resilience, and renewed hope for a better future.

Small NGOs are emerging as the future of development work in India’s changing community-development landscape. Rooted in communities, these grassroots organizations contribute directly and meaningfully, moving beyond earlier models of sub-letting and passive roles. What once remained recessive is now becoming dominant—power with communities, not power over them.
In this evolving scenario, small NGOs must transform themselves internally to stay relevant and effective. Administrative systems, HR policies, financial management, governance, and compliance mechanisms need to be strengthened and aligned with the standards of funding agencies and government frameworks. Equally important is refreshing the way ideas are conceptualized and translated into action—sharper problem analysis, clearer theories of change, stronger monitoring, and impact-driven ex*****on.

Grassroots NGOs are driving real change on the ground—reaching the most marginalized, innovating local solutions, and sustaining community trust. Yet today, many of them struggle to survive. With FCRA funding increasingly restricted, the development sector in India is now heavily dependent on CSR support. While CSR presents opportunities, it also brings complex compliance requirements that small, impact-driven organizations often find difficult to meet. Strengthening partnerships, simplifying processes, and building trust are critical and potential solutions if we truly want impact at scale. 🌱
